> Are they paid to type code or create programs?

The goal is more to understand why something is true than just whether it is true. To oversimplify a lot, it's the difference between industry versus academic motivation. In the former case you have a point, but not so much in the latter. We really need both modes of work going on.

> As a not math person, seems strictly good that AI can solve more problems.

As a math person I think that's probably true, though it's not that simple. We do still have to understand the solutions to the problems, and take time to explore. That's how we figure out what problems should be solved in the first place. Cognitive debt is bad enough in your codebase, but you don't really want it to overwhelm entire academic disciplines.

The futures I predict, out of my ass, for when the LLM wildfire spreads enough:

1. We are in a situation that the pace crumbles, in which situation we are left with classes of problems LLMs simply cannot touch because they have exhausted the "low hanging fruits" that their training and architecture was optimised for solving. In this scenario there is still stuff for the mathematicians to do, but the way young research mathematicians get trained has to be adjusted.

2. Or we simply see some slowdown, but it is still fast enough that it overtakes human capacities and produces novel mathematics that are harder and harder to understand, as LLMs are adapting to solve more and more types of problems faster than humans, while more and more fields are transcribed into lean. I guess if that happens the main role would be to clean up the llms' work, trying to get some gist out of it to build theories, and guide the llms for those with access to them. But not sure how many mathematicians will have access to these advanced LLMs to work with, so this may create big issues. Until now funding of mathematical work was somewhat trivial, they would only have expenses for traveling, conferences, and phds and postdocs, compared to other fields that need labs, equipment, high compute and/or research assistants to function.
